Full description

Flux data from the Dargo High Plains site in sub-alpine NE Victoria (37 08'00.4"S, 147 10;15.3"E; 1648m). Site is a seasonally grazed (bovine), sub-alpine grassland system comprised principally of Poa spp. and various herbaceous species. Site is subject to seasonal (May-October), semi-permanent snow cover. Carbon dioxide, water vapour and heat are quantified using an open-path eddy covariance technique. Additional measurements at this site include: temperature, relative humidity, incoming/outgoing shortwave radiation, incoming/outgoing longwave radiation, global and diffuse PAR, outgoing PAR, soil heat flux, soil temperature (5,10,20,30,40,50 cm depths) and soil moisture (5,10,20,30,40,50 cm depths) and rainfall.

Data time period: 07 2010 to 06 04 2011
